When you love your job, it shows in many ways. When you’re the community director of an apartment complex like Evelyn Carter at Velo on the Boulevard Apartment Homes<\/a> in Salt Lake City, you’re motivated to find ways to share that spark with the residents who live in that community.

\nInspired by Daniel Kageyama’s ”Love Notes” – communities can show love for their residents by doing simple things that “surprise and delight” – Carter decided to share that concept with the residents in her apartment community as a way of encouraging them to feel a deeper sense of connection to the place they call home.

\n“The people are the best thing about our community,” said Carter. “We have awesome residents – they’re very active here, both with each other and when attending the resident events we host every month.” Carter said she knows her residents feel the love because “we always have a great turnout at our events. People really seem to enjoy getting to know each other… getting to know their neighbors, and they keep coming back for more.”
